Three rebels killed, 4 injured including NPA leader, cop

Three New People’s Army rebels were killed and four were injured, including a high raking NPA leader and a policeman, in an encounter in Barangay Tabu, Ilog in Negros Occidental at about 7:20 a.m. Tuesday, PLt. Col. Ryan Manongdo, 6th Special Action Force Battalion commander, said.

One surrendered and nine other persons found near the encounter site are being held for questioning, Manongdo said.

He identified the injured rebel leader as Nilda Natander Bertolano secretary of the NPA Southwest Front who sustained bullet wounds in the thigh and arm.

The injured policeman, who was wearing a bullet proof vest, is out of danger, Manongdo said.

He said his troops and the 2nd Negros Occidental Provincial Force Company went to Barangay Tabu, which is a remote area, after receiving information of a mass gathering of NPA rebels.

On arriving in the area they engaged about 20 plus rebels in a one hour and 10-minute battle, Manongdo said.

They have yet to identify the slain rebels and their two other injured companions, Manongdo said.

The police recovered four M-16 rifles from the scene of the encounter, he added.*
